May, 2015OSHA Ruling on Confined Spaces
Protecting Workers in Confined Spaces The rule will provide construction workers with protections similar to those manufacturing and general industry workers have had for more than two decades, with some differences tailored to the construction industry. These include requirements to ensure that multiple employers share vital safety information and to continuously monitor hazards – a safety option made possible by technological advances after the manufacturing and general industry standards were created.

December, 2013Important OSHA Recordkeeping Alert
Important OSHA Recordkeeping Alert! On November 7, 2013, OSHA announced its proposed new rule to improve tracking of workplace injuries and illnesses. The first proposed new requirement is for establishments with more than 250 employees (and who are already required to keep records) to electronically submit the records on a quarterly basis to OSHA.
